发布于 2015-01-24 17:39:51
This简短直截了当的教程应该会对您有所帮助
在Windows上安装APCu
假设
的windows web开发平台。
使用说明
Pre:根据wamp安装文件夹和PHP/apache版本的不同,所有目录位置可能会有所不同。
请转到http://pecl.php.net/package/APCu,有一个表格列出了更适合您的版本(支持您的php版本的最新稳定版本)
)
C:\wamp\bin\php\php5.5.6\ext
.php_apcu.dll
复制到C:\wamp\bin\apache\apache2.4.9\bin
打开php.ini
,然后添加以下行(我只是在文件末尾添加了它们):apcu extension=php_apcu.dll apc.enabled=1 apc.shm_size=32M apc.ttl=7200 apc.enable_cli=1 apc.serializer=php
这些是位于php_apcu归档的安装文件中的推荐配置,除了DLL file.
PHP,那么您只需在C:\wamp\bin\php\php5.5.6\bin\php.ini
中添加您在步骤5中添加到apache的php.ini中的配置行。
结束了!
发布于 2017-02-14 05:07:35
适用于那些想要具有向后APC兼容性的APCu (无需更改代码库的1:1替换,例如apc_cache_info
> apcu_cache_info
)
php_apcu.dll
下载release page (选择合适的PHP版本、架构和线程安全模式)ext
目录下的两个文件<代码>H114在<代码>D15中加载扩展:
php.ini
中的extension=php_apcu.dll extension=php_apcu_bc.dll
APCu apc.enabled=1 apc.shm_size=32M apc.ttl=7200 apc.enable_cli=1
信息: APCu-BC 1.0.3的APC扩展必须准确命名为php_apcu.dll
才能工作。当我将其命名为XAMPP时,php_apcu_bc-1.0.3-7.1-ts-vc14-x86.dll
没有正确启动(关于缺少php_apc.dll
的错误)
补充说明:从上面下载的用于vc15的压缩文件包含一个名为php_apc.dll的文件(在文件:'php_apcu_bc-1.0.4-7.2-ts-vc15-x86.zip‘日期: 13/06/2018) -只是将其重命名为php_apcu_bc.dll worked。
发布于 2020-07-13 22:26:41
如果使用DLL的线程安全或非线程安全版本,这一点很重要。对我来说,只有在Windows10 x64和PHP7.4中使用内置服务器的NTS才能工作。这很令人困惑,因为当运行PHP -i无法加载动态库'php_apcu.dll‘(尝试: ext\php_apcu.dll)时,msg php会给出错误消息,就好像文件不在那里一样。
https://stackoverflow.com/questions/24448261
复制相似问题